"Pros
* Good selection of food for breakfast (cereals, yogurt, fresh fruit (apples and oranges), peach slices, pineapple rings, melon chunks, three different pastries (including pain a chocolate, croissants), coffee, cappacino, tea etc)
* Clean
* Good size room
Cons
* Some staff were inattentive (receptionist in particular), but some were lovely.
* Lots of traffic noise (but this appears to be a common feature in hotels in Rome)
* Our double bed was two singles pushed together (but with a double sheet and duvet etc)
* No shower curtain and shower was not fixed to wall (you had to hold it to shower)"

"I recently stayed for a short break in this hotel with my boyfriend and we could not fault it. The room was cleaned daily with fresh towels every morning and the staff were extremely friendly and helpful with local information. Breakfasts were simple cold continental but there seemed to be something for everyone and there were plenty of fresh trays coming out regularly. The only downside is that the hotel does not have a bar or restaraunt so if you would like any evening entertainment and a nice meal you have to travel into town on the local bus, which by the way is very easy if you don't mind the local buses and it's only 2 stops. There are two small restaurants next door which are fairly cheap but you do get what you pay for and they were a little of a let down and just down the next street there is a rather large parade of shops offering everything form pizzas to pet food. I would definately return to this hotel as it offered excellent value for money. Oh one other tiny downside was the fact that the hotel is situated on a busy road which does make it easy to find and the noise was no problems whatsoever as once inside it could not be heard but you do have to cross the 5 lanes of traffic to get to the bus stop on the other side of the road but make sure you use the crossings or you wont stand a chance."
